Output 2523829235210f3a462995f40b4b01b3b4618e57b3aacd15c8881f4495717e54:86

value
116013
script pubkey
OP_0 OP_PUSHBYTES_20 d969c6173ab8ab89e90b56317cefc26dee1c6708
address
bc1qm95uv9e6hz4cn6gt2cchem7zdhhpcecg5nvyl9
transaction
2523829235210f3a462995f40b4b01b3b4618e57b3aacd15c8881f4495717e54
spent
true